hi, this may sound a bit silly but i just want to make sure before i buy an ipad and get cubasis. I need to know if i can listen to both playing a vsti , eg piano, while singing through a mike with effects. I like to write this way. Works fine on my pc setups in the past…I just realized garage band wont do this , well i couldn’t get it to…so just checking its not an ipad thing…also will latency be an issue?

Hi,
something like the following setup is possible:
Connect an external keyboard to your iPad and use it to play Cubasis’ external sounds, for instance the piano. You can do this via USB or MIDI.
Sing through the built-in Microphone and listen to it with effects using headphones.
You can also use compatible Audio- and/or MIDI-Interfaces. You can find a list of compatible devices on the product page (Cubasis: Music Creation App for iOS & Android | Steinberg ). Further information about what you can do with Cubasis is available in the manual (http://www.steinberg.net/fileadmin/files/PRODUCTS/Apps/Cubasis/Cubasis.pdf ).
